Is there a service on the Fediverse where, an instance's mods can filter out specific keywords from showing on local timelines automatically?

Mastodon, being popular, has a feature with filter blocking for the user level. But no such feature for the mods them selves to help them moderate their communities. I think even Lemmy could benefit from potential ease of moderation

Is/should their be an option where moderators can auto block potentially offensive words used in uses posts, on their local timeline or beyond?
